Key takeaway
The company specializes in designing and commercializing autonomous robots that efficiently deliver food, drinks, and small goods within indoor commercial environments like hotels and hospitals. Their innovative approach includes the development of the first mobile robot that is soft and pressure-sensitive, enhancing safety and interaction in delivery tasks.

When exploring the Warehouse Robotics industry in Italy, several key considerations emerge. The regulatory environment is crucial; compliance with EU standards on safety and efficiency must be prioritized. This includes adhering to regulations regarding worker safety and data protection, which can influence the adoption of robotics technologies. Challenges such as the high initial investment cost and the need for skilled labor can impact company growth and innovation. However, opportunities abound as Italian businesses increasingly seek automation to enhance efficiency and reduce operational costs, particularly in logistics and manufacturing sectors. The competitive landscape is evolving, with both established companies and startups vying for market share, often focusing on tailored solutions for specific industries. Environmental concerns are also gaining traction, as sustainable practices and energy-efficient technologies become essential in the design and operation of warehouse robotics. Furthermore, the global market relevance of Italy's warehouse robotics sector is significant, given the country's strategic position in Europe and its robust industrial base. As companies look to expand their operations, understanding these dynamics can provide critical insights for making informed decisions in the warehouse robotics field.
